Historic Significance of Topkapi
Topkapi Palace,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, stands as an icon of Istanbul's rich history and the splendour of the Ottoman Empire. As you explore its vast premises, you'll uncover the layers of background that formed not just the city however the entire region. Constructed in the 15th century, this palace served as the administrative facility and residence of sultans for virtually 400 years. You'll discover that it housed substantial artefacts, including spiritual relics and royal collections, showcasing the wealth and power of the Ottomans. Each space narrates, showing the social and political evolution of the realm. What Is the Ideal Time to Visit Istanbul?
The most effective time to visit Istanbul is throughout spring or autumn. You'll delight in moderate weather condition and fewer groups, making it less complicated to discover the city's abundant history and vibrant society without really feeling overwhelmed.
How Do I Browse Public Transport in Istanbul?
To navigate mass transit in Istanbul, you'll intend to get an Istanbulkart. Utilize it on cable cars, ferries, and buses. Acquaint yourself with routes using apps, and do not think twice to ask locals for aid.
